Elevated Safety Standards for Data Center Sites
Safety is always the highest priority, especially on high-risk data center project sites. When you are working with Moss Utilities, rest assured knowing our proactive, in-house safety program is led by Safety Advisors who bring specialized certifications and an on-site presence to manage complex risks.

- We equip our crews with specialized, task-specific PPE and adhere to strict badge-access security.
- Our team holds OSHA 500/510 and NFPA 70E credentials, ensuring we protect both our people and your energized infrastructure.
- Daily Job Safety Analysis (JSA) and Pre-Task Planning keep operations secure.
Core Capabilities for Data Center Projects
At Moss Utilities, we offer customized solutions for every client. Each project is unique, which is why we are proactive about designing the ideal structure based on your individual needs. Some of these core capabilities include:
- Wet Utilities (Water, Sewer, Storm Drainage, Fire Lines): These critical systems often require redundant water feeds to minimize risk. We ensure your facility has the reliable infrastructure needed to stay online 24/7/365.
- Electrical & Duct Bank Excavation: From thermal management in high-density duct banks to rigorous mandrel testing, our work meets tolerances far stricter than standard commercial projects. We ensure 100% clear pathways for high-voltage and fiber pulls.
- Mechanical & Dry Utility Excavation: Data center civil engineering is rarely static. Our teams adapt immediately to shifting engineering requirements for mechanical systems and dry utilities, solving challenges in the field to keep your schedule moving forward.
- BIM Modeling & As-Built Surveys: We maintain high-quality standards every step of the way, ensuring precision and subsurface certainty before and after excavation so that your as-builts are perfectly accurate.
